DATED : 11th August, 2016 Heard.

We do not find any ground to review the order dated 20/7/2016 in Writ Petition No.3789/2016.

However, since it is the claim of the petitioners that some of the petitioners are transferred to a place which is at a distance of more than 100 - 200 kms. from the place of the posting of their spouse, it would be necessary for the respondent-Zilla Parishad to consider the representation made by the spouse of such petitioners to the Zilla Parishad for their transfer in the same tribal areas in which the petitioners are posted, Shri J.B.Kasat, the learned counsel for the respondentZilla Parishad states that if the spouse of such petitioners are ready to locate themselves in the tribal areas where the petitioners are posted, they may make an application-

representation for their transfers to the same tribal area and the Zilla Parishad would consider the same appropriately. Hence, we dispose of the Review Application with a hope and trust that the Zilla Parishad would consider the application made by the spouse of the concerned petitioners for their transfer to the tribal areas where the petitioners are transferred, within a short time, so that the policy of giving a place of posting to the spouse within a short distance, could be implemented, as far as possible.
